    I'm a newbie to the wonderful world of emulation and I have a question I'm hoping someone could help me with. I used to have Nesticle to play old NES games and I have an old nintendo controller hooked up to my hard drive. It works great with Nesticle.

    But I just download a new emulator. Called FCEU. It's a great emulator, but I cannot figure out how to get my nintendo control to work. I went to Configure-Input, but I'm not sure what to do.

    Does anyone know how to configure the FCEU emulator to use an old nintendo controller plugged into my hard drive? Please help. I'm desperate to start playing again. Thanks.

    Quote Originally Posted by tomacetw
    But I don't know what the configuration is supposed to be. I can't even figure out how to use the keypad right now.
    In the Config --> Input options, make sure all the NES-style input ports are set to "Gamepad", then click on "Configure" in the port 1 (player 1 of course). You'll see control maps for player 1 and 3 (need to configure only player 1).

    Press each button you want to assign. For example...

    Click on "Up" button and then press "Up" on the D-pad of the Nintendo controller, and do the same with the rest. Nothing difficult though...
